Cream buns and crime /

By: Stevens, Robin, 1988- [author.]Material type: TextTextSeries: Murder most unladylike collectionPublication details: London : Puffin, 2017Description: 271 pages : illustrations (black and white) ; 20 cmContent type: text | still image Media type: unmediated Carrier type: volumeISBN: 9780141376561 (pbk.) :Subject(s): Wells, Daisy (Fictitious character) -- Juvenile fiction | Wong, Hazel (Fictitious character) -- Juvenile fiction | Detective and mystery stories, English | Children's stories, English | Fiction 9+ | Adventure | Short storiesDDC classification: 823.92 Summary: Daisy Wells and Hazel Wong are famous for the murder cases they have solved - but there are many other mysteries in the pages of Hazel's casebook, from the macabre 'Case of the Deepdean Vampire', to the baffling 'Case of the Blue Violet', and their very first case of all: the 'Case of Lavinia's Missing Tie'. Packed with brilliant mini-mysteries, including two brand-new and never seen before stories, and peppered with Daisy and Hazel's own tips, tricks, and facts, this is the perfect book for budding detectives and fans of the award-winning, bestselling 'Murder Most Unladylike' series.
